The shipping market is at the forefront of embracing brand-new technologies to improve effectiveness, security, and sustainability. This article analyzes a few of the crucial technological developments presently forming the modern-day shipping sector.
One of the most notable developments in the shipping market is the execution of advanced analytics and machine learning. These technologies enable shipping business to evaluate huge quantities of information to optimise paths, predict maintenance needs, and improve overall operational effectiveness. By using predictive analytics, companies can expect equipment failures and schedule maintenance proactively, minimizing downtime and preventing expensive repair work. Artificial intelligence algorithms likewise assist in optimising fuel usage by evaluating different elements such as weather, sea currents, and vessel efficiency. These data-driven insights allow shipping companies to make informed decisions, resulting in cost savings and boosted performance.
Another substantial technological improvement is the advancement of wise shipping services. These services integrate various digital innovations, such as IoT, automation, and blockchain, to develop a more connected and efficient shipping ecosystem. IoT gadgets make it possible for real-time tracking of freight and vessels, offering valuable details on area, temperature level, humidity, and other conditions. Automation technologies, such as autonomous cranes and drones, are being utilized in ports to enhance operations and minimize human error. Blockchain innovation, as pointed out earlier, enhances openness and security in supply chain deals. The integration of these clever shipping options is revolutionising the market, making it more nimble, transparent, and trustworthy.
Sustainability remains a critical focus in the modern-day shipping industry, with technological advancements playing a vital role in attaining ecological goals. The advancement of cleaner and more efficient propulsion systems, such as LNG and hydrogen fuel cells, is assisting to decrease greenhouse gas emissions. In addition, using renewable energy sources, such as wind and solar energy, is gaining momentum in the market. Some companies are explore innovative styles, such as wind-assisted propulsion systems and solar-powered vessels, to harness natural energy and decrease dependence on fossil fuels. In addition, developments in hull style and coverings are enhancing fuel efficiency by lowering drag and increasing vessel speed. These sustainable technologies are necessary in meeting worldwide regulations and promoting a greener future for the shipping industry.
